NESTLE India daily chart technical analysis and potential Elliott Wave counts

NESTLE India daily chart is progressing higher to terminate its fifth wave at multiple degrees as marked here with potential target towards 3050 mark. The stock is subdividing within Minor Wave 5 Grey as Minute Wave ((iii)) poised to push through 2900 zone.

The stock carved a low around 1600 in May 2022, Intermediate Wave (4) Orange. The subsequent rally has subdivided into five Minor Waves 1 through 5, with bulls progressing within the last leg against 2330; Minor Wave 4 low registered on June 04, 2024.

If the above holds well, the stock is now unfolding Minor Wave 5 and is within Minute Wave ((iii)) at the time of writing. Prices should ideally stay above 2600 levels to hold the above impulse.

Nestle India four-hour chart technical analysis and potential Elliott Wave counts

NESTLE India 4H chart highlights the sub waves within Minor Wave 4 between 2770 and 2600, a potential zigzag at Minute degree. Further Minute Wave ((ii)) within Minor Wave 5 was a combination. The recent price action suggests Minute Wave ((iii)) progressing higher towards 2900-10 zone against 2450.
